Food processing facilities face high volumes of dust and particulate matter as a byproduct of various production stages, such as milling, grinding, and mixing. Dust removal systems in this sector are essential for maintaining clean air quality and preventing contamination in the production environment. These systems are often integrated into production lines, where they capture dust particles before they have a chance to spread into other areas. This is particularly critical in food manufacturing, where even minor contamination can compromise the integrity of the final product and lead to food safety issues. A well-maintained food dust removal system is vital to ensure that processing facilities remain compliant with safety standards and regulations.
In addition to safeguarding the product quality, food dust removal equipment also plays an essential role in improving operational efficiency within food processing plants. With the continuous operation of large machinery, the amount of airborne dust can quickly escalate, leading to equipment wear and reduced efficiency. By capturing dust early in the process, these systems prevent buildup on machinery and other components, reducing the frequency of maintenance and extending the life cycle of equipment. Furthermore, effective dust control measures help mitigate the risks of fire or explosion in high-risk food processing environments, providing a safer workplace for employees and protecting businesses from potential liabilities.
Food packaging facilities are another critical application area for food dust removal systems. During the packaging process, dust particles can easily transfer onto food products, compromising their quality and safety. Whether the packaging involves sealing, labeling, or other automated processes, dust removal equipment plays a pivotal role in maintaining the integrity of both the food product and its packaging. These systems help to remove particles from the air and the surrounding environment, ensuring that packaged food remains free from contaminants that could lead to spoilage or degradation. Furthermore, clean packaging environments are essential for meeting regulatory standards and consumer expectations for hygiene and product quality.
The dust removal systems employed in food packaging plants also assist in maintaining a clean and efficient production line. By preventing the accumulation of dust in packaging machinery, these systems reduce the risk of mechanical failures and ensure smooth operations. Additionally, as the packaging process often involves large quantities of food being sealed or prepared for distribution, dust removal systems are critical for maintaining consistent production speeds. The use of these technologies in food packaging helps businesses meet their productivity goals while ensuring that they maintain the high hygiene standards required in the food industry.

What technologies are commonly used in food dust removal systems?
Common technologies include HEPA filters, electrostatic precipitators, cyclonic separators, and activated carbon filters for efficient dust and particle capture.
